Title
Microsoft Windows Cloud Files Mini Filter Driver权限提升漏洞(CNVD-2026-17154)
Description
Microsoft Windows Cloud Files Mini Filter Driver是美国微软(Microsoft)公司的一款云文件过滤器驱动程序。 Microsoft Windows Cloud Files Mini Filter Driver存在权限提升漏洞,该漏洞是由Cloud Files Mini-Filter Driver组件中的不受信任的指针解引用缺陷引起的。攻击者可利用该漏洞提升权限。
